SCT gives you more options with custom tuning. Not sure why you'd get anything else, the SCT hardware is just a platform to push the code in with. The code is the important part, and there are a half-dozen plus custom tune writers that have good histories with the 6.0L.
Innovative can apparently write custom tunes for certain Bully Dog tuners, but Gearhead, Quicktricks, KEM, River City, and Truck Source all for sure write for the SCT and have good histories.

The transmission killers where always the shift on the fly boxes, like the Edge Juice with Attitude. Bully Dog had several boxes I think, Banks had the 6 Gun, those where the ones with problems. New Edge boxes don't have the problems, there's just no one who can tune for them anymore since PHP stopped the Gryphon.

With both being the same company now it offers the advantage of having the same quality of tune from an SCT on the Bully Dog units. The GT Platinum will accept custom tuning, and the other prior models will not. In all likelihood with a new model coming out (the BDX), the old models will most likely not be updated.
